A multiple-choice test has 32 questions, each with
four response choices. If a student is simply guessing
at the answers,
a. What is the probability of guessing correctly for
any individual question?
b. On average, how many questions would a student
answer correctly for the entire test?
c. What is the probability that a student would get
more than 12 answers correct simply by guessing?
Answer:
a. The probability of guessing correctly for any individual question is 1/4, since there are four response choices and only one of them is correct.
b. On average, a student would answer 8 questions correctly for the entire test by guessing. This is because there are 32 questions and each question has a 1/4 chance of being answered correctly, so 32 x 1/4 = 8.
c.To calculate the probability of a student getting more than 12 answers correct simply by guessing, we need to use the binomial distribution formula. The formula is:
P(X > k) = 1 - Σ P(X = i), i = 0 to k
where P(X > k) is the probability of getting more than k correct answers, P(X = i) is the probability of getting exactly i correct answers, and Σ represents the sum from i = 0 to k.
In this case, k = 12, since we want to find the probability of getting more than 12 correct answers. The probability of getting exactly i correct answers can be calculated using the binomial distribution formula:
P(X = i) = C(32, i) * (1/4)^i * (3/4)^(32-i)where C(32, i) is the number of ways to choose i correct answers out of 32 questions.
By plugging in the values into the first formula, we can find that the probability of a student getting more than 12 answers correct simply by guessing is approximately 0.097 or 9.7%. This means that a student has a relatively low chance of getting more than 12 answers correct by simply guessing on the test.
(t)What is the difference between
{2, 3} and {{2, 3}}?
\(\{2,3\}\) is a set containing two elements - numbers 2 and 3
\(\{\{2,3\}\}\) is a set containing one element - a set \(\{2,3\}\)

Two cards are randomly selected without replacement from a pile of cards labeled with the letters A, E, R, S, and T. What is the probability that both cards are consonants?
Part A: Find the sample space
Part B: What are the favorable outcomes?
Part C: Calculate the probability of selecting 2 cards that are consonants. Show all of your work to support your answer.
Part A:The sample space contains 20 possible outcomes.
Part B :there are 3 favorable outcomes.
Part C:The probability of selecting 2 cards that are consonants is 3/20.
What is he probability of the event?The proportion (relative frequency) of times an event is anticipated to occur when an experiment is repeated a large number of times under identical conditions is known as the probability of the event.
Part A: When two cards are selected from the pile, the set of all possible outcomes known as the sample space is created. Since one of the five cards has already been selected, there are five choices for the first card and four for the second.
As a result, the sample space contains 20 possible outcomes, or 5 x 4.
Part B: There are 3 consonants in the arrangement of cards: R, S, and T, so the number of ways to choose two consonants from the set of three is one of the favorable outcomes. The following combination formula can be used to find this:
f = (number of ways to choose 2 consonants from 3)
= C(3,2)
= 3
So there are 3 favorable outcomes.
Part C: The probability of selecting two consonant-containing cards in the sample space is the product of the number of favorable outcomes and the number of possible outcomes.
P(selecting two consonants) = f / n,
where n is the number of possible outcomes in the sample space and f is the number of favorable outcomes.
Substituting the values we found in parts A and B, we get:
P(selecting 2 consonants) = 3 / 20
Therefore, the probability of selecting 2 cards that are consonants is 3/20.

Adding and subtracting polynomials
Answer:
The expression to find the perimeter is 12x² - 6, and the perimeter when x= 1.5 is 21
Step-by-step explanation:
The perimeter is the sum of all side lengths for a 2d shape, such as this triangle. Our perimeter is thus
4x² - 3 + 4x² - 2 + 4x² - 1
We can then separate our variables and constants to make it
4x² + 4x² + 4x² - 3 - 2 - 1
Add the constants to get
4x²+4x²+4x² - 6
To add variables, we must first make sure that they are the same variable/letter as well as to the same degree. The coefficient only affects the result. Because all of our variables are the same letter (x) and are all to the second degree, we can add them. To do this, we simply add the coefficients together to make one big coefficient, and multiply that by the variable. Thus,
4x² + 4x² + 4x² = (4+4+4)x² = 12x²
4x²+4x²+4x² - 6 = 12x² - 6
Another way of looking at it is that 4x² = 4(x²) = x²+x²+x²+x²
Therefore, the expression to find the perimeter is 12x² - 6, and the perimeter when x= 1.5 is 12 * 1.5² - 6 = 21
